Posting in from the Greek Island of Longevity...Ikaria

Ikaria is a part of 'Blue Zones' a name given to 5 places in the world- Ikaria, Sardinia in Italy, Okinawa of Japan, Nicoya of Costa Rica and Loma Linda of California, USA, whose inhabitants surpass the life expectancy and reach over the age of 90 years. Now, what are the major factors, that give Ikarians longevity?
